·FY 2025Job description
We are seeking a Software Development Engineer to enhance connectivity through innovative software solutions. This role involves integrating AI with wireless technologies to create intelligent systems that improve user experience. The engineer will work on various software stacks, ensuring high performance and reliability. Collaboration with cross-functional teams will be essential to achieve the best results.
Requirements
- BS in Computer Science or equivalent field
- Strong knowledge of data structures and algorithms
- Experience developing software using Objective-C/Swift, Java, or C/C++
- Deep understanding of operating systems including process, filesystems, and memory management
- Experience using AI to enhance software features
- Strong understanding of networking and TCP/IP protocols
- Hands-on development and troubleshooting expertise, including GDB and shell scripting
- Excellent communication skills to explain complex technical concepts
- MS or PhD in Computer Science or equivalent field
- Experience developing libraries for inter-process communication
- Knowledge of IEEE 802.11/Wi-Fi protocols and standards
- Experience developing on Apple platforms using Xcode
- Familiarity with secure coding practices
Responsibilities
- Develop features across software stacks from concept to shipping.
- Integrate AI to enhance Wi-Fi functionality and improve internal systems.
- Design and implement advanced Wi-Fi features for Apple products.
- Collaborate with engineers from various teams to achieve project goals.
